Last Friday before the quarterfinal clash between France and Spain in the UEFA Euro 2012, Spanish players Cesc Fabregas and Gerard Pique took to the table tennis table to warm up.
This video became viral on Weibo where Chinese table tennis professionals including Ma Long, Xu Xin, Zhang Jike and head coach Liu Guoliang discussed the video. Ma Long, Xu Xin and Zhang Jike are huge fans of the Spanish football team and are often seen wearing the national t-shirts during training.
Thanks to tabletennista.com for the translations on Liu Guoliang's comments on the video.. "Just watched them play. Pique's handling was good while Fabregas' speed was quite fast. If in a real competition, the result will depend on who will be able to chop. More transitions will be the key." Liu Guoliang said.
The equipment seemed poor said Liu Guoliang and he said I would consider sending the Spanish National team a DHS Olympic table
